Sunday Morning | August 20, 2023 | John C. Majors | Louisville, KY

On August 20, 2023, during the 85th anniversary celebration, the sermon revolved around the theme "Use It or Lose It." The central biblical principle was that not actively remembering leads to forgetting. The focus was on how God blessed the church, through the stories of four key individuals. Lula Tyree initiated the idea of a Sunday School, which grew into a thriving church. Maurice "Rosie" Roberts contributed his generosity, providing land and support for the church's growth. Gene Cook's dedicated service as a humble and passionate leader, especially in investing in the next generation, left a lasting legacy. Finally, Larry and Sharlett Peercy's unwavering commitment and service, particularly during a challenging period of decline, inspired others to rebuild and serve. The sermon encouraged walking by faith, being generous, investing in the next generation, and serving, as these qualities propel the church forward into the future with growth and community-building. The reopening of the Fellowship Hall was seen as a testament to these values and a call to continue the church's mission of service and outreach.
